Tobacco Concessions Tender Announced In Hungary
- 3 Apr 2015 9:00 AM
- shopping
The National Tobacco Sales Nonprofit Company (NDN) announced another tender for tobacco sales concessions. The tender is the sixth called for concessions since Hungary introduced a state monopoly on retail tobacco sales in July of 2013. It is for concessions in 490 communities.

Hungarian Lawmakers Pass Law On Banning Unprofitable Supermarkets
- 10 Dec 2014 8:00 AM
- shopping
Lawmakers approved a government law on banning from 2018 supermarkets and hypermarkets that fail to make a profit for two consecutive years. The law which bans the outlets from selling daily consumer goods passed with 116 in favour, 34 against and 25 abstentions.
